Researching Stallion Naming Traditions

Stallion naming traditions vary across different breeds and cultures. Some breeds have strict naming rules, such as using specific letters or words, while others allow more flexibility. It’s essential to research the naming conventions of your horse’s breed and consider them when choosing a name.

For example, Thoroughbred horses must have unique names that are no more than 18 characters long, including spaces. They cannot use specific words such as "horse" or "stallion" and cannot duplicate the names of any other registered Thoroughbred. On the other hand, Arabian horses often have names that reflect their Bedouin heritage, such as "Al Khamsa" or "Bint," meaning "daughter of." Understanding these traditions will help you choose a name that fits your horse’s breed and culture.
